Implement Service Management Basics to Boost Your Business

Service management basics cover the essentials of creating a business that is committed to exceptional customer service delivery. The provision of good customer service can set your organisation head and shoulders above the competition, so it is important to get the delivery customer service right. Deliver of high standards of customer service will help you build customer loyalty and ensure that you create a long term relationship with the customer that keeps them coming back to your organisation a service provision.
About service management
In its most simplest form, service management is about improving customer service delivery in your organisation. In order to achieve exceptional customer service, a service management strategy will foster best practice, help customer service people to meet key targets and ensure that each employee in your business is committed to outstanding customer service in line with the vision and direction of your company or organisation.
The key points of service management basics
In order to improve service management and develop a company culture of exceptional customer service provision, service management basics should cover the following:
Vision - A vision is the direction and focus of the business. When you possess a clear vision for your business and you encourage every employee in your organisation to embrace the vision of your business, you have the means to improve your service delivery. Employees who are nurtured and who have a company vision they can truly believe in are the employees who will meet and exceed the customer service delivery goals in your organisation.
Strategies - Developing solid strategies gives you a clear blueprint to follow when it comes to service management in your business. Build those strategies by reflecting upon the vision you have for the business and considering how you can foster a desire in your employees to adhere to the vision of the business. When every employee in the organisation shares a common vision across all levels, this will foster a spirit of cooperation that will ensure each individual works within the team to achieve a common purpose and reach service management targets.
Goals - Defining and sharing the goals and objectives of the company helps every employee to gain a clear sense of what they are working towards and how their role plays a part in achieving these goals. This helps when it comes to service management, as the goals that are set in place define the direction the company will take and the way in which it will meet its service delivery targets.
If you are looking to improve the delivery of customer service in your business, then implementing strategies to cover service management basics is the key to building a customer driven culture in your workplace. As a small business you may find that you are able to define the vision, strategies and goals in a more informal way to improve service delivery and help a small, tight-knit group of employees stay committed to a common purpose. With medium to large business, the need for a to develop a more formal vision and set clear goals and guidelines is needed to ensure that all employees understand their role in fulfilling the vision of the organisation.
